Facilities Ticket — Cleaning Crew Access, Brindle Annex

For new starters handling evening lock-up: the Sorano Cleaning crew arrives nightly at 21:30 via the annex side door. Check their rota sheet, note arrival in the log, and ensure the storeroom is relocked afterward. To let them through the side door, enter the access code below.

badge for yaweg-hafog: bdg-GX-6

14:22 — The Quillbrook platform team began the rolling upgrade of the Fernwhistle message broker from 4.2 to 5.0. Authentication plugins were re-verified before each node rejoined the cluster. No credential material was rotated during the window, and TLS settings carried over unchanged. At 14:51 all nodes reported healthy. The upgrade build is identified by the token below for audit purposes.

trace token, fafog-kageg: htk4_98e6

Handover Note — Orveth Licensing Dispute

To the board, and to Marisol as she takes this over: the dispute with Quillane Systems concerns their claim that our Orveth toolkit exceeds the seat count in the 2022 agreement. Our counsel thinks their reading is a stretch, but settlement talks are live and reasonably friendly. Key dates, drafts, and counsel's memos are in the shared dispute folder. Don't commit to any figure before the next board call. How this ties into our wider plans is set out in the note below.

internal memo for kawip-hadug: Headcount on the Wenwyn team goes from 7 to 140 by the end of January. Gross margin on Wenwyn came in at 20 percent against a plan of 15 percent.

Alert: MIGRATION_DUAL_WRITE_DRIFT. The Ledgerbird schema migrator has detected row-count divergence between the old and new tables during a zero-downtime migration. This usually means one write path was disabled prematurely or a backfill worker stalled. Do not cut over traffic while this alert is firing — doing so risks silent data loss. Pause the cutover, confirm both write paths are active, and restart the backfill. The full remediation procedure is on the internal page.

dashboard of bafof-hafog = https://confluence.lumiclabs.internal/display/browse/display/6a09a20a